Sony DLP Lamp XL-2000 How-To Replacement Guide

For Part Number: Sony DLP Lamp XL-2000 (Sealed replacement lamp for DLP televisions, SMALL lamp, SEALED lamp)

Tools Required: Phillips screwdriver, a pair of pliers, and a new lamp.

Time Required: About 15 minutes

Necessities:

1. A Phillips screwdriver
2. A Pair of Pliers
3. A new Philips Lamp
4. 15 minutes of your time

NOTE: The bulb should be handled with a clean lint-free cloth at all times to avoid any dirt or oil. Our hands are naturally oily…The oil residue from our hands can cause premature failure of the lamp if the front side of the lamp is not wiped down after the installation. It doesn’t hurt to do a final wipe with a clean, non-abrasive, lint-free cloth before reinstalling your lamp…

Examine the enclosure.  
Sony XL-2000 P22h lamp and enclosure
Identify the screws holding the metal housing in place. We'll get that off first.
Sony XL-2000 P22h lamp and enclosure
Use the Philips screw drive to remove the top metal and plastic piece.  
Sony XL-2000 P22h lamp and enclosure
There should be two of these screws.
Sony XL-2000 P22h lamp and enclosure
Pull the two pieces apart.  
Sony XL-2000 P22h lamp and enclosure
You'll see the wires are still attached to the connection and the terminals.
Sony XL-2000 P22h lamp and enclosure
Use your pliars to remove the nut from one of the terminals on the lamp.  
Sony XL-2000 P22h lamp and enclosure
Loosen the scerw from the terminal.
Sony XL-2000 P22h lamp and enclosure
Remove both wires, and move them so they are out of the way.  
Sony XL-2000 P22h lamp and enclosure
Remove the wire clamp holding the lamp in place. Pinch inward.
Sony XL-2000 P22h lamp and enclosure
Pull down, then up.  
Sony XL-2000 P22h lamp and enclosure
You can now dismount the lamp.
Sony XL-2000 P22h lamp and enclosure
This is what it should look like at this point.  
Sony XL-2000 P22h lamp and enclosure
Now we have to remove the lamp from the cover.
Sony XL-2000 P22h lamp and enclosure
This is easily done with your screw driver.  
Sony XL-2000 P22h lamp and enclosure
At this stage, you should have quite a few pieces laying about--DON'T LOSE THEM!
Sony XL-2000 P22h lamp and enclosure
Install the new lamp and reverse the proceedure.  
Sony XL-2000 P22h lamp and enclosure
Place the lamp and front cover back into the housing.
Sony XL-2000 P22h lamp and enclosure
Make sure the lamp fits in properly, then reattach the wire clamp.  
Sony XL-2000 P22h lamp and enclosure
Hand tighten the nut to the terminal after attaching the wire to the end of the lamp.
Sony XL-2000 P22h lamp and enclosure
DO NOT OVER TIGHTEN. Excessive torque can break the terminal.  
Sony XL-2000 P22h lamp and enclosure
Your front piece is complete, so set it back into the rest of the housing.
Sony XL-2000 P22h lamp and enclosure
This is what your lamp should look like when it's complete.  
Sony XL-2000 P22h lamp and enclosure
Top view, showing the ballast connector.
Sony XL-2000 P22h lamp and enclosure
This is the back side of the enclosure.  
Sony XL-2000 P22h lamp and enclosure
 
Sony XL-2000 P22h lamp and enclosure
The lamp should fix snug into the enclosure, and you should be able to see it.   Sony XL-2000 P22h lamp and enclosure You're done!
